I posted this picture the other day looking for help about what might be wrong. Someone suggested that it could be a warped heatbed, and that had me worried. I thought maybe instead it was a problem with my Frostbite plate... was I flexing it too much? Did I damage it? I had been focusing mostly on one side of the plate, but when I looked on the other side, the side that I always have down because it got a PLA stain, I saw a bunch of tiny pieces of printing debris. So I tried the Textured PEI plate that came with the printer. Worked great. No problems. And now the same with the Frostbite. I generally do not use the Textured PEI plate because it releases too easily. I ruined a very small print because of this.
